Earnings for Criminal Justice & Corrections Graduates from Fitchburg State University
Those who finish Fitchburg State University’s Criminal Justice & Corrections program earn at the following median levels (per the U.S. Department of Education’s College Scorecard):
| Years After Graduation | Median Earnings |
|---|---|
| 1 year | $35,607 |
| 2 years | $38,048 |
| 3 years | $51,244 |
| 4 years | $52,693 |
| 5 years | $61,088 |
How does this compare to the school overall? Four years out, Criminal Justice & Corrections graduates from Fitchburg State University report median earnings of $52,693, compared with $66,598 for all Fitchburg State University graduates — about 21% lower than the school-wide median.
Median Debt at Graduation
Median student loan debt for Criminal Justice & Corrections graduates from Fitchburg State University is $26,000.

Criminal Justice & Corrections Master’s Program at Fitchburg State University
Among the 31 master’s criminal justice & corrections graduates at Fitchburg State University, 23% were women (7) and 77% were men (24).
The following table and chart show the race/ethnicity of Criminal Justice & Corrections master’s degree recipients at Fitchburg State University.
| Race / Ethnicity | Number of Graduates |
|---|---|
| White | 27 |
| Hispanic / Latino | 2 |
| Two or More Races | 1 |
| Unknown | 1 |
Minority students account for 10% of Criminal Justice & Corrections master’s degree recipients at Fitchburg State University, below the national average of 47%.*
*The racial-ethnic minorities figure is the total number of graduates minus White, international (nonresident), and unknown-race graduates.
